The Vitis Unified IDE is a design environment for developing applications for AMD Adaptive SoC and FPGA devices. The Vitis Unified IDE embraces a bottom-up design flow that lets you develop components of a system: C/C++ sourced HLS components, RTL design kernels, software applications, and then integrate the components into a top-level system project as shown in the following figure. The single unified development environment provides all the features you need to compile, run, debug, and analyze the different elements of an heterogeneous embedded system design, or an FPGA-accelerated Data Center application.
The Vitis Unified IDE lets you create, synthesize C/C++ code into RTL designs using HLS components, run C-simulation and C/RTL Co-simulation; review and analyze build and run summaries in the newly integrated Vitis analyzer tool.

You can perform the following tasks with the Vitis Unified IDE:
- Design programmable logic with C/C++ by creating HLS components
- Develop System projects for AMD Alveo™ Data Center accelerator cards
